SE Labs leads UK cybersecurity testing shift

A wave of cybersecurity firms have abandoned the Department of Defense-backed MITRE test as major companies join independent cyber testing programme PIVOT, run by British company SE Labs.  Participants in MITRE Engenuity ATT&CK Evaluations plummeted from 30 to just 11 last year. Meanwhile, CrowdStrike, Palo Alto Networks and Broadcom are among the participants confirmed for PIVOT, a 6-month testing programme by SE Labs evaluating how effectively vendors can defend against the world’s most dangerous hacking groups and attack techniques. Testing critical cyber solutions  “It’s a landmark moment for British cyber security, as the world’s biggest and best organisations choose to test their critical cyber solutions in the UK rather than in the US,” said Simon Edwards, CEO of SE Labs. “There are now very few tier-one vendors that aren’t testing within PIVOT.” “The requirements for cyber security have completely changed. There are autonomous AI agent attacks, such as those that affected Hugging Face, while the sheer economic scale of the JLR incident influenced the UK economy. Businesses need to know which solutions actually protect them against nation-state attacks, major ransomware campaigns and machine-speed threats, and that demands rigorous testing of defences.” PIVOT testing The PIVOT testing will see teams of trained ethical hackers from SE Labs impersonate nation-state cyber groups and other hacking circles responsible for the most disruptive cyber breaches in recent years, replicating attack types across ransomware, malware, phishing and beyond to stress test vendor solutions on their ability to detect threats from known attack groups and protect against them. Authority insights Adam Bromwich, Vice President of Engineering and CTO, Enterprise Security Group at Broadcom, said: "CISOs today need clarity and proof, not just promises. PIVOT emphasises full transparency and inclusion of major analyst firms to set a new standard for trust. For us isn't just about a score; it's about demonstrating Symantec and Carbon Blacks' real-world efficacy in an open, verifiable way that empowers customers to make confident security investments." Simon Reed, Chief Research and Scientific Officer (CRSO) at Sophos, said: “SE Labs’ PIVOT brings clarity to endpoint testing. It highlights who’s genuinely preventing and detecting threats, not just tuning for test conditions. As cybersecurity focuses increasingly on prevention and resilience for real-world protection, this independent assessment is critical to retain trust.”  Independent scrutiny on test results The data from testing is shared with analyst firms for independent scrutiny ahead of publication to help vendors identify gaps in their security solutions and support product development against ongoing threat groups and attack types. The test portion of the programme runs from July to October, with the final report released in January 2027. It comes amid the development of the Cyber Security & Resilience Bill, which will mandate designated essential services and digital service providers to report incidents within 24 hours to the regulator and NCSC and a full report within 72 hours, widen regulatory scope, and promote cross-border information sharing with EU authorities under NIS2.

Axis joins Frontier AI critical defense program

Axis Communications, a pioneer in network video, announces it has joined a strategic initiative, the Frontier AI Critical Defense Program, created by Palo Alto Networks to protect critical infrastructure from Frontier AI-driven exploits. As a founding partner in this program, Axis will collaborate with Palo Alto Networks to provide joint customers with advanced, network-level protections designed to mitigate the risks associated with AI-accelerated exploits. The rise of Frontier AI models is significantly accelerating the rate at which vulnerabilities are discovered and weaponised, increasing the patching burden on organisations worldwide. Axis knows its devices and solutions operate in sensitive environments like government facilities and critical infrastructure. Disrupting critical operations The rise of using IP devices as sensors means they not only perform their primary function but also provide critical metadata for real-time processes. Due to this, faster patching is needed to keep this critical data secure. The program addresses this exact challenge, ensuring that customers' distributed edge networks and high-value data streams remain protected against AI-accelerated threats without disrupting critical operations. To address these challenges, the initiative enables Axis to securely coordinate with Palo Alto Networks to develop and deliver high-quality “virtual patches” at the network layer. These protections provide a critical layer of "air cover," allowing organisations the time they need to test and roll out official software updates without being exposed to security risks. Resilient product ecosystem Through this collaboration, Axis can strengthen protection for customers while deepening its roles within the broader cybersecurity ecosystem. The insights gained through this partnership will further strengthen the company’s ability to refine its own vulnerability management and remediation efforts, providing a more resilient product ecosystem for its customers. “In a landscape where AI is shortening the window between vulnerability discovery and exploitation, collaboration is essential,” said Sebastian Hultqvist, Manager Platform Solutions, Axis Communications. “By joining this initiative as a founding partner, we are providing our customers with a proactive safety net. This coordination not only protects our customers today but also provides us with valuable insights to continuously improve our security posture.” Next-generation connected devices "Frontier AI has made it possible for cyber threats to find and target software flaws faster than traditional patching can keep up," said Qiang Huang, Vice President Product Management, Palo Alto Networks. "By working with technology leaders like Axis, our program delivers proactive protection to joint customers by blocking threats at the network layer, giving critical infrastructure operators the time they need to safely deploy permanent fixes, while enabling strong business outcomes with next-generation connected devices."

Zero Networks expands Palo Alto integration: AI focus

Zero Networks, the provider of Zero Trust security solutions, announces a major expansion of its integration with Palo Alto Networks, extending the companies’ joint solution from automated microsegmentation and firewall policy orchestration to zero-touch containment and AI security. The original integration combined Zero Networks’ automated asset discovery, dynamic tagging, and identity-driven microsegmentation with Palo Alto Networks Next-Generation Firewalls. The expanded integration enables customers to use Zero Networks to identify and contain threats at the individual asset level, redirect selected traffic to Palo Alto Networks security services for deeper inspection, and manage enforcement through Strata Cloud Manager. The integration also brings together Zero Networks AI Segmentation and Prisma AIRS to govern AI agents and inspect AI traffic. Continuously mapping communication Rather than deploying separate controls for the perimeter, internal network, and AI environment, customers can apply consistent protection across on-premises, cloud, OT, Kubernetes and hybrid infrastructure. Zero Networks enables zero-touch containment by continuously mapping communication between assets and automatically creating least-privilege policies based on observed business activity. Through the expanded integration, selected traffic from protected workloads can be redirected to Palo Alto Networks firewalls for deeper Layer 7 inspection, enabling the platforms to block suspicious activity and contain affected assets before threats spread. Traffic redirection is available today for Linux environments, with Windows support planned, extending deep inspection and automated containment to Windows systems across the enterprise attack surface. Identity-based policies Zero Networks-managed assets and policies can now be surfaced through Strata Cloud Manager, giving security teams a consolidated view of discovered assets, segmentation policies, and the Palo Alto Networks controls inspecting their traffic. Dynamic asset tagging keeps policies current as workloads move, IP addresses change, and new assets appear, reducing the need to manually maintain static firewall rules. The expanded integration brings Zero Networks AI Segmentation together with Palo Alto Networks Prisma AIRS to provide security controls for AI agents and their traffic. Zero Networks identifies and governs AI agents, applying identity-based policies to restrict each agent to approved systems and destinations, while blocking unsanctioned AI services. When deeper inspection is needed, selected AI traffic can be redirected to Prisma AIRS for AI-aware threat prevention, combining control over where AI agents can connect with inspection of their prompts, responses, and data flows. Identity-based microsegmentation “Zero Networks controls which connections are allowed, Palo Alto Networks provides deep inspection,” said Benny Lakunishok, Co-founder and CEO of Zero Networks. “Together, we can contain malicious activity before it can move across the environment.” The joint solution enables organisations to: Contain compromised assets automatically with zero-touch, identity-based microsegmentation. Redirect selected traffic for Layer 7 inspection through Palo Alto Networks firewalls. Manage assets and policies through Strata Cloud Manager for unified visibility and enforcement. Govern AI agents and inspect AI traffic using Zero Networks AI Segmentation and Palo Alto Networks Prisma AIRS. Synchronise asset context with Palo Alto Networks Dynamic Address Groups. Dynamic asset tagging The integration uses existing Zero Networks and Palo Alto Networks enforcement capabilities, allowing customers to expand protection without redesigning the network or manually writing thousands of segmentation rules. The expanded integration between Zero Networks and Palo Alto Networks is available now, including automated microsegmentation, dynamic asset tagging, policy synchronisation, and Linux traffic redirection.
